‘No Kings’ protests against Trump bring a street party vibe as GOP calls them ‘hate America’ rallies

WASHINGTON (AP) — Protesting the direction of the country under President Donald Trump, people gathered Saturday in the nation’s capital and communities across the U.S. for “No Kings” demonstrations.

These protests have been described by the president’s Republican Party as “Hate America” rallies. Participants carried signs with messages such as “Nothing is more patriotic than protesting” and “Resist Fascism.”

Slipknot Sue Slipknot.com Domain Squatter After 24 Years

A cyber-squatter has been occupying the domain slipknot.com for 24 years. During this time, they have been using the URL to advertise counterfeit merchandise associated with the metal band Slipknot.

Now, Slipknot has taken legal action and is suing to reclaim the domain name. This move aims to protect the band’s brand and prevent the sale of unauthorized products.
